Bachelor’s degree in Computer Science, Engineering, or a related field (or equivalent experience) and able to demonstrate high proficiency in programming fundamentals.
5-10 years experience
At least 4 years of proven experience as a Data Engineer or similar role dealing with data and ETL processes.
Strong knowledge of Microsoft Azure services, including Azure Data Factory, Azure Synapse, Azure Databricks, Azure Blob Storage and Azure Data Lake Gen 2.
Experience utilizing SQL DML to query modern RDBMS in an efficient manner (e.g., SQL Server, PostgreSQL).
Strong understanding of Software Engineering principles and how they apply to Data Engineering (e.g., CI / CD, version control, testing).
Experience with big data technologies (e.g., Spark).
Strong problem-solving skills and attention to detail.